Abstract

This paper presents the preliminary results of an interdisciplinary activity which provides the collaboration of archaeologists and computer scientists. In particular this work is related to an extension of a commonly adopted model for representing stratigraphic diagrams aimed at increasing its expressiveness and supporting the analysis and interpretation of the related data to support the detection of archaeological phases.
